I suggest adding

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

"I suggest adding" is a correct and usable phrase in written English.
You can use it when you want to make a suggestion to add something to a particular situation. For example, "I suggest adding another layer of security to our online databases."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"I suggest adding", follow it with a specific and actionable item. Be clear about what you are suggesting to add and where it should be added for maximum impact.

Common error

Avoid using "I suggest adding" without specifying what should be added or why. Ensure the suggestion is concrete and provides a clear benefit to the context.

Linguistic Context

The phrase "I suggest adding" functions as a directive speech act, specifically offering a recommendation or suggestion. It combines a personal perspective (I) with an action-oriented verb phrase (suggest adding), influencing the recipient to consider incorporating something.

FAQs

How can I use "I suggest adding" in a sentence?

Use "I suggest adding" followed by the specific element you recommend incorporating into the situation. For example, "I suggest adding a section on user feedback to the report".

What's a more formal alternative to "I suggest adding"?

For a more formal tone, consider phrases like "I propose adding" or "I recommend including".

Is it always necessary to use "I" before "suggest adding"?

While it's common to include "I" to indicate personal suggestion, it is possible to say just "Consider adding" or "It is suggested to add" in certain formal contexts.

What is the difference between "I suggest adding" and "I suggest to add"?

"I suggest adding" is grammatically correct and the more common phrasing. "I suggest to add" is less common and can sound awkward. Always use "I suggest adding" followed by a noun or gerund.
